Dementia Care in Bolingbrook

Dementia care is built on routine and on not arguing. A predictable day — same hours, same face, same order of things — does more to reduce distress than almost anything else available, and a caregiver who knows how to redirect rather than correct can change the character of an entire afternoon.

Being at home is part of the treatment rather than just a preference. Familiar surroundings hold meaning that new ones cannot, and someone who seems lost in an unfamiliar building is often markedly steadier in their own front room.

The rest is watchfulness — the stove, the front door, the stairs, whether meals are actually being eaten — and honest reporting back to the family about what is changing. A caregiver in the house several times a week notices drift long before a monthly visit would.

What dementia care includes

  • Consistent daily routines and familiar caregivers
  • Gentle redirection and de-escalation
  • Supervision for wandering and safety concerns
  • Support through sundowning and difficult afternoons
  • Engagement through music, photographs and familiar activities
  • Respite and guidance for exhausted family caregivers

How do you handle repeated questions?
Patiently, and without pointing out the repetition. The question is usually a way of checking that things are alright, so the answer that works is reassurance rather than information.
Can care increase as the dementia progresses?
Yes, and it usually should. Many families start with a few hours a week and build toward daily visits, overnight cover, or continuous care over a period of years, with the same caregivers wherever possible.
